How often should a restaurant get five stars when you're denied a table?Well, let me tell you our story.Me and my three colleagues from the US just got out of an all-day meeting, only to find out that it was raining, and none of us had umbrellas. Thus we Yelp'd nearby restaurants, and found the Chancery, a 4.5 star restaurant, nearby. When we got there, it was clear that they were hosting many company holiday dinners. We asked about a table for four, and they checked, but they said they were totally booked and could not accommodate us. That is where the story at a regular restaurant ends. When we asked if they could call us a taxi so that we could just go back to our hotel, since it was impossible to hail a taxi from the street because of the rain, a gentleman (whom I'll assume was the manager or owner) said that he would call his friend at a nearby restaurant, and if they could accommodate us, he would walk us over IN THE RAIN. Well, they were booked too. So, we asked if they could call a taxi for us. This gentleman said that he would go out into the rain to get us a taxi and bring it back to the restaurant to pick us up. WHO DOES THAT? Sure enough, he disappears into the rainy night, while we wait inside the warm, dry restaurant. A couple of minutes later, a taxi pulls up, and out pops this gentleman to let us know that our taxi has arrived.Wow. Again, WHO DOES THAT? Well, apparently, the folks at the Chancery do. Dear Sir, whomever you may be, I hope you see this review, and I hope you realize how much we appreciated your kind and generous gesture, and how much we look forward to visiting your restaurant the next time we're in town. If your 4.5 star rated food is anything close to the level of service you provided to a "denied" customer, then it's a gross injustice that your restaurant is not a 5 star restaurant.Thank you again for helping us 'mericans to stay dry on a wet London night. Your simple act of kindness was truly appreciated.

Be the first to ReplyPosh restaurant close to Lincolns Inn Fields.
Went for a work 'group dinner' with a fixed menu that included an appetizer (I chose the mackerel), a main (I chose the beef) and a dessert (I chose the pistachio cake).Service was attentive, fast and efficient. Food was well presented and tasty, but portion sizes were rather meager.Nice atmosphere, well presented and tasty food and a generally nice all around venue. Nice for a work group dinner or a romantic night on the town.Hint: watch your step around the dining room. A few odd placed small steps may trip you up.
Be the first to ReplyGreat place for a quiet dinner.
The decor is very neutral professional - the perfect place for a business lunch. But works for dinner as well. Speaking of which, dinner and weekends are half price for the £35 three course menu, although be prepared for the 12.5% service charge to be on the full price and not the half price food.The food itself is creative and beautifully presented, and tastes good too. Service is efficient.A great choice for dinner in the area, which is devoid of other good dinner places.
